YOUR GUT IS THE FIRST LINE OF DEFENCE
The immune system is made up of a posh, high-level community of cells, tissues and organs that work collectively to combat off invaders.
The 70 per cent of immune tissue that lies inside our intestine has a very vital job, as a result of our digestive tract is essentially the most accessible gateway into the physique.
It’s a fairly powerful job, actually. The intestine immunity crew is continually on patrol, sifting by tens of millions of overseas cells every day and discriminating between the innocent (reminiscent of pleasant microbes) and doubtlessly harmful ones (for instance, mycotoxins present in mouldy meals and flu-causing viruses).
This immune tissue additionally retains the remainder of our cells in test by assessing outdated cells, that are extra susceptible to cancer-forming mutations, and deciding which of them must be made to retire.
The intestine is the rationale we’re not all bedridden and defeated by an infection each time we eat or step exterior.
Like all powerhouses, our physique has two most important traces of defence: our intestinal wall, which acts as a bodily barrier to overseas invaders (like a bouncer on the door exterior a membership), and the extra refined and dynamic immune system (assume safety cameras, alarms and so forth).
The wall of our gut is made up of a barrier of cells — think about a row of doorways which can be successfully secured by tight junctions. Our intestinal wall serves a twin objective. Like the door and the bouncer who guards it, the wall permits the nice guys (vitamins) to go and retains out the dangerous guys (pathogens).
However, these tight junctions can change into weak, or unfastened, once we’re burdened; not getting sufficient vegetation in our weight loss plan; or have had one too many cocktails. As a end result, undesirable nasties can sneak throughout the intestinal wall. Scientists name this intestinal hyperpermeability; a extra user-friendly time period is ‘leaky intestine’.
Thankfully, even when a pathogen does make it by the primary line of defence, our immune system is primed and ready to pounce, triggering occasions each inside and out of doors our intestine to close down any nasty invasions.
BE SURE TO FEED YOUR MICROBES
The actual secret weapon in our physique’s defence system is the colony of microbes dwelling in our intestine, often known as our intestine microbiota. Without them, our immune system would, frankly, be fairly weak.
Helpful microbes line the complete digestive tract, from the mouth (the place they work with enzymes within the saliva to start out the digestive course of), proper by to the acidic abdomen and the size of the small and enormous intestines.
They carefully monitor every part you eat and drink, neutralising toxins and germs earlier than they will do an excessive amount of injury.
Importantly, these microbes elevate indicators for the immune system to reply if obligatory. They’re additionally in control of ‘coaching’ our immune system so it could higher shield us.
More particularly, intestine microbes train our immune system what’s price reacting to and what’s secure.
This is why, in case your intestine microbes are imbalanced — with too many ‘dangerous’ microbes — you may find yourself with a poorly skilled immune system that overreacts to harmless bystanders (cue allergy symptoms and autoimmune situations, the place proteins in meals reminiscent of peanuts are mistaken for the enemy) and underreacts to the actual dangerous guys (giving a free go to chilly and flu-causing viruses).
Without our intestine microbiota, our immune system can be fairly inefficient — assume newbie athlete versus elite athlete. I do know who I’d somewhat have on my aspect.
We additionally want a wholesome inhabitants of intestine microbes to assist us break down and digest our meals in order that the immunity-enhancing vitamins in every meal may be launched into the bloodstream. And, in return for feeding them, these microbes have a intelligent sideline in producing ‘postbiotics’ — byproducts of digestion that play a big position in intestine and immune well being.
For occasion, postbiotics set off indicators that dial down irritation, decreasing the disagreeable signs we expertise once we’re in poor health (irritation, which causes a excessive temperature, is the physique’s means of serving to to kill off viruses), and activating therapeutic by fuelling cell restore.
Generally talking, the extra various your intestine microbes, the higher the breadth of abilities the ‘crew’ possesses — and the higher your total well being. This possible explains why individuals with decrease immunity are inclined to have a much less various group of intestine microbes, based on a examine revealed within the journal Nature by researchers from Harvard Medical School.
So, probably the greatest methods we are able to assist our immunity is by supporting our intestine microbes and preserving our weight loss plan various and plant-based.

MAKE THE SUPER SIX YOUR CORNERSTONE
Thanks to the fibre, prebiotics and polyphenols (plant chemical compounds) they comprise, there isn’t a query that vegetation are our microbes’ favorite meals.
But growing the plant-based meals in your weight loss plan is as a lot about high quality as amount.
Highly processed plant meals which have been stripped of their wholefood goodness, reminiscent of refined grains and cereals, ultra-processed vegan burgers and pastries, fruit juices, and concentrated sugars reminiscent of jams, agave, honey and syrups, is not going to assist your intestine microbes.
What you should deal with as an alternative, because the core of any consuming plan, is what I name The Super Six: wholegrains, fruits, greens, nuts and seeds, legumes (beans and pulses), and herbs and spices.
Each of those plant meals teams supplies your physique and your intestine micro organism with the completely different fertilisers they need and wish.
